AIG Must Face Trademark Claims Again After 8th Cir. Reverses Win

Isaiah Poritz
Isaiah Poritz
Legal Reporter

AIG Inc. must face trademark infringement claims from a smaller insurance company with a similar name after the Eighth Circuit on Friday reversed AIG’s win in Missouri federal court.

The US Court of Appeals for the Eighth Circuit said the trial court failed to properly evaluate AIG’s argument that AIG Agency Inc., a family-owned insurance brokerage, took an inexcusably long time to bring the infringement claim.
